Canadian Teens think America is “Evil”

This article in the Toronto Free Press (a discordant, conservative Canadian publication) claims that over 40% of Canadian teens think the US is “evil”. The author roundly criticizes this:

The poll results reflect that anti-Americanism will be solidly entrenched in future generations of Canadians. As well as listening to the propaganda espoused by their political leaders and the media, these kids have no experience with what constitutes real evil. They live in a country that much like pre-9/11 America, thinks that terrorist attacks are something that happens in other countries. And as the World War II veterans slowly die off, they have no conviction of the evil that the allies risked their lives to defeat.

Never to be outdone, 64% of French Canadians agree with the “evil” characterization.
